Stade Sheikh Mohamed Laghdaf
Stade Sheikh Mohamed Laghdaf (Arabic: ملعب الشيخ محمد لغضف) is a multi-use stadium located in Laayoune, Western Sahara. It is used mostly for football matches. The stadium has a maximum capacity of 15,000 people[1] and is home the JS Massira football club of Laayoune.
